About Scorpion Solitaire

Scorpion Solitaire brings a fresh twist to classic card play with quick drag-and-drop action. You build sequences from King to Ace, trying to clear the board without getting stuck. This free game tests your patience and logic, offering a fun challenge that keeps you hooked for hours.

Player Questions

How do I win at Scorpion Solitaire?

You win by clearing all cards from the board. Focus on building sequences from King down to Ace and uncovering hidden cards in the columns.

What are the controls for Scorpion Solitaire?

You use basic drag-and-drop commands. Click a card, drag it to a valid spot, and it will snap into place if the move is allowed.

Can I play Scorpion Solitaire on my phone?

Yes, it works on mobile, but the controls can feel awkward sometimes due to the drag-and-drop layout.

Are there cheat codes for Scorpion Solitaire?

No, there are no cheat codes. The game relies on real gameplay and your strategy to clear the sequences.
